The reason nobody is panicking is there is now almost no one in the Western world who remembers a pandemic disease. I am fortunate enough to have interviewed a man on the occasion of his 105th birthday who told me a bit about the Spanish flu pandemic of 1918 – 1920.

Spanish flu hit towards the end of World War I, and spread to every corner of the world including the arctic and remote Pacific Islands. It infected 500 million people and resulted in an estimated 50 to 100 million deaths. That would be three to five percent of the world’s population at the time.

By the way, the disease’s origin is not known. The connection with Spain is only because Spain as a neutral country did not have wartime censorship. Thus the false impression grew that Spain had been especially hard hit.

Mortality rates for the flu ranged from 23 percent to 71 percent, and oddly the overwhelming majority among young people. Of pregnant women who survived the flu, a quarter miscarried.

Almost a century later with the incredible technology we have available, there is so much we just don’t know about the Ebola/Marburg virus and how it kills.

It does seem to come from the Hot Zone, the tropics of Africa. Versions of the virus are found in monkeys, pigs, and bats. There is a less virulent strain found in monkeys and pigs in the Philippines.

It is spread by contact with body fluids, which leak explosively from the victim in the final stages of the disease.

According to the World Health Organization, “The incubation period, that is, the time interval from infection with the virus to onset of symptoms is 2 to 21 days. Humans are not infectious until they develop symptoms. First symptoms are the sudden onset of fever fatigue, muscle pain, headache and sore throat. This is followed by vomiting, diarrhea, rash, symptoms of impaired kidney and liver function, and in some cases, both internal and external bleeding (e.g. oozing from the gums, blood in the stools).”

That’s good news about the incubation period, you can’t spread the disease until it’s evident you’ve got it.

The bad news is, it may be very difficult to contain. Some reports have it that surgical gloves and masks may not be enough and recommend full Hazmat suits. One of the highest at-risk groups has been medical personnel.

The worst news is, if an infected person does not show symptoms until up to three weeks after exposure that’s plenty of time to fly somewhere else and spread it. But so far the governments of the U.S. and Europe have ruled out suspending air travel from affected areas.

In the developed world we’ve pretty much controlled the historically common plague vectors: contaminated water, droplet infection, and insects.

Incurable sexually transmitted disease reemerged with AIDS, but can be prevented by changing behavior. (With difficulty for sure.)

Ebola could be the wild card which potentially overwhelms our public health infrastructure if it ever gets a foothold.

I have no answers, but I’m going to recommend a very good book, “Plagues and Peoples” by William McNeill. And if you get ambitious, Hans Zinsser’s classic, “Rats, Lice and History: A Chronicle of Pestilence and Plagues.”
